Air conditioners are essential appliances for maintaining a comfortable indoor environment during hot and humid months. However, over time, dust, dirt, and other debris can accumulate in the air conditioner vent, which can restrict airflow and reduce the efficiency of the unit. Regular cleaning of the air conditioner vent is crucial for optimal performance and longevity.

Why Clean Air Conditioner Vent?

Cleaning the air conditioner vent offers several benefits:

  • Improved Air Quality: A clean vent allows for better airflow, removing dust, pollen, and other allergens from the air, resulting in cleaner and healthier indoor air.
  • Increased Efficiency: A clogged vent obstructs airflow, forcing the air conditioner to work harder and consume more energy. Cleaning the vent improves efficiency and reduces energy bills.
  • Extended Lifespan: Regular cleaning helps prevent the accumulation of debris that can damage the air conditioner’s internal components, extending its lifespan.
  • Reduced Noise: A clean vent allows for smoother airflow, reducing the noise produced by the air conditioner.

How to Clean Air Conditioner Vent

Cleaning an air conditioner vent is a simple task that can be completed in a few steps:

1. Turn Off the Power: Before starting, ensure the air conditioner is turned off and the power supply is disconnected for safety.
2. Remove the Vent Cover: Locate the air conditioner vent cover, which is usually held in place by screws or clips. Carefully remove the cover.
3. Vacuum the Vent: Use a vacuum cleaner with a soft brush attachment to remove loose dust and debris from the vent.
4. Clean the Vent Cover: Wash the vent cover with warm soapy water and a soft cloth. Allow it to dry completely before reinstalling it.
5. Clean the Vent Opening: Use a damp cloth or sponge to wipe down the inside of the vent opening, removing any remaining dust or dirt.
6. Inspect the Air Filter: While you have the vent open, check the air filter for dirt and debris. If the filter is dirty, replace it with a new one.
7. Reassemble the Vent: Once the vent and cover are clean, reassemble them and secure them in place.

Additional Tips for Cleaning Air Conditioner Vent

  • Regular Cleaning: Clean the air conditioner vent at least once a month, especially during peak usage months.
  • Use a Soft Brush: When vacuuming the vent, use a soft brush attachment to avoid damaging the fins.
  • Avoid Chemicals: Do not use har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ners on the vent, as they can damage the surface.
  • Check for Blockages: If you notice reduced airflow or increased noise from the air conditioner, check the vent for any blockages, such as furniture or curtains.

FAQ

1. How often should I clean my air conditioner vent?

  • You should clean the air conditioner vent at least once a month, especially during peak usage months.

2. What type of vacuum cleaner should I use to clean the vent?

  • Use a vacuum cleaner with a soft brush attachment to avoid damaging the fins.

3. Can I use a wet cloth to clean the vent opening?

  • Yes, you can use a damp cloth or sponge to wipe down the inside of the vent opening, but ensure it is completely dry before reassembling the vent.

4. What are the signs of a clogged air conditioner vent?

  • Reduced airflow, increased noise, and higher energy consumption are all indicators of a clogged air conditioner vent.

5. How can I prevent my air conditioner vent from getting clogged?

  • Regular cleaning, using a high-quality air filter, and avoiding placing furniture or curtains too close to the vent can help prevent clogging.
